END-OF-SUPPORT NOTIFICATION (EoS) for Ribbon 5110 & 5210 Series Session Border Controllers (SBC)

As of October 16, 2023, if you are still utilizing 5110 & 5210 SBC s, your network's security is vulnerable to cyber attacks.

As technology evolves, so do the methods used by cybercriminals to exploit vulnerabilities in networks. Updated hardware and software is required to safeguard your network.

NOTE: Ribbon (Sonus) 5100 & 5200 SBCs EoS expired February 2, 2020.
